Operations in Cardiothoracic Surgery
When procedures alone arenโt enough, surgery may be the best option. Renova performs a broad spectrum of common cardiothoracic surgeries, ensuring safety and long-term results.
Types of cardiothoracic surgery we perform include:
- Coronary Artery Bypass Grafting (CABG): Restores blood supply in blocked arteries.
- Valve Repairs & Replacements: Treats leaking or narrowed heart valves.
- Aortic & Thoracic Aneurysm Repairs: Prevents rupture of life-threatening aneurysms.
- Lung Surgeries: Lobectomy, pneumonectomy, and wedge resections for cancer and other conditions.
- Oesophageal Surgeries: For cancer, reflux disease, or strictures.
- Paediatric Cardiothoracic Surgery: Congenital heart defects in children.
- Minimally Invasive Surgeries: Smaller cuts, less pain, quicker recovery.
- Robotic Cardiothoracic Surgery: For highly complex chest and heart operations, offering micro-precision.

When Should You See a Cardiothoracic Doctor?
Heart and lung issues often show early warning signs. Ignoring them can delay treatment and increase risks. You should consult a cardiothoracic doctor if you notice:
- Persistent chest pain or pressure.
- Breathlessness that worsens with activity.
- Swelling in the legs or abdomen.
- Coughing up blood or a long-standing cough.
- History of heart attack, valve disease, or blocked arteries.
- An enlarged heart is seen on X-ray (increased cardiothoracic ratio).
- Unexplained fatigue or fainting spells.
A timely check-up with a cardiothoracic vascular surgeon can prevent complications and, in many cases, save lives.
